JOB SUMMARY
The Food and Nutrition Manager is responsible for the leadership, operations, and regulatory compliance of all food and nutrition services. This role ensures safe, high-quality, nutritionally appropriate food service that supports patient care, employee dining, and visitor services, while maintaining strict adherence to federal and Wyoming regulations.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Leadership & Operations:
- Lead daily food service operations, including patient meals, cafeteria, catering, and special dietary needs.
- Supervise, coach, and develop dietary staff, including scheduling and performance management.
- Ensure patient satisfaction, while balancing quality, efficiency, and cost control.
- Collaborate with nursing, clinical nutrition, infection prevention, and leadership teams.
Regulatory & Compliance
- Maintain full compliance with CMS conditions of participation, Wyoming department of health and food safety regulations, FDA food code (as adopted by Wyoming).
- Ensure proper documentation of therapeutic diets and meal substitutions.
- Participate in care-plan meetings, as appropriate.
- Keep accurate logs for temperatures, sanitation, cleaning schedules, and corrective actions.
- Maintain constant survey readiness for state and federal regulations.
- Lead food safety, sanitation, and infection prevention practices.
- Prepare for and manage regulatory surveys, audits, and inspections.
Food Safety & Quality
- Oversee menu planning and therapeutic diets in collaboration with dietitians.
- Ensure proper food handling, storage, preparation, temperature control, and infection controls.
- Support liberalized diets where clinically appropriate to enhance quality of life.
- Maintain accurate documentation related to food safety, sanitation, and dietary compliance.
- Manage departmental budgets, inventory, purchasing, and vendor relationships.
- Monitor food costs, labor productivity, and waste reduction initiatives.
- Implement process improvements aligned with organizational goals.
- Performs other duties, as assigned.
S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ES:
- This position has supervisory responsibilities of all dietary staff and reports to the Director of Support Services
